This is a remote position. We are looking for a highly organized and detail-oriented Virtual Medical Assistant (VMA) to join our team. The successful candidate will be responsible for supporting healthcare providers with administrative and clinical tasks, ensuring smooth workflow, and enhancing patient care. This is an excellent opportunity for someone with experience in healthcare administration or medical assisting who is looking to advance their career in a dynamic and supportive remote environment. Key Responsibilities: • Manage patient scheduling, appointments, and reminders. • Assist with medical documentation, including charting and updating electronic health records (EHR/EMR). • Handle insurance verifications, pre-authorizations, and referral coordination. • Communicate with patients via phone, email, or messaging to address inquiries, follow-ups, and appointment confirmations. • Process prescription refills and coordinate with pharmacies as needed. • Assist providers with telehealth visits by documenting patient encounters in real time. • Maintain accurate and up-to-date patient records while ensuring compliance with HIPAA and confidentiality regulations. • Perform basic billing support, including verifying patient insurance coverage and handling prior authorizations. • Coordinate with medical staff and other healthcare professionals to facilitate smooth patient care. • Manage administrative tasks such as data entry, report preparation, and handling correspondence. Requirements: Minimum Qualifications: • Must be a Spanish Speaker (bilingual preferred). • 6 months to 2 years of experience as a Medical Assistant, Virtual Medical Assistant, or similar healthcare role. • Experience with electronic medical records (EMR/EHR) and telehealth platforms. • Strong communication skills, both verbal and written. • Ability to multitask in a fast-paced healthcare environment. • Highly organized with excellent problem-solving and time management abilities. Knowledge & Skills: • Spanish Speaker (required for patient interactions and documentation). • Proficiency in EHR/EMR systems such as Athena health, eClinicalWorks, or similar platforms. • Familiarity with medical terminology and HIPAA compliance regulations. • Strong knowledge of medical office procedures, patient scheduling, and insurance verifications. • Ability to work independently while collaborating effectively with healthcare providers. • Attention to detail and critical thinking skills to ensure accuracy in documentation and patient care. • Strong problem-solving skills and adaptability in a remote healthcare setting.
